  2. Just received the following email from grubb000 a few minutes ago about something I have in the classifieds.

    "Hello ,
    I'm really glad with the content of your mail,Thanks so much for
    everything, Please help me take proper care of it because I believe by
    now it belongs to me.I am okay with
    the price and condition of the ITEM..Please DO NOT respond to anybody
    again .About the shipment,I will take care of that myself.. I shall
    contact a shipping company
    that normally does that for me.I shall pay in US Money order or
    Cashier Check that will clear into your account within 24/48 hours
    before will can proceed on the shipment
    immediately after it clear you will deduct your own cost and transfer
    the rest of the fund to the shipping company in order for them to come
    for the pickup of item to take
    place in your location... I am really glad that you want me to get the
    ITEM and my family will be happy also when I get it,Because i
    really needed it for presentation Please email me back today. I'll
    need your data for the check, viz;
    FULL NAME.......
    CONTACT ADDRESS........
    ASKING PRICE............
    CITY........
    STATE............
    ZIP CODE.........
    PHONE NUMBER.........
    Please mail me today to let me know I am the rightful owner...and also
    to let you know that the payment will be issued out within 48
    hours..here is my phone number
    (575) 618-3115 for more details...Thanks for selling to me.am located
    in CHICAGO IL....
    Cheers"

    PS. I didn't reformat anything, that's how the e-mail was laid out.

    From the description of the video it sounds like they want to make deployment on large wingsuits easier. This is what the description said

    "We are a bunch of people who strongly believe that the wingtip pouch should become THE standard among wingsuit deployment systems!
    The goal of this work is to make parachute opening much more easier when flying a (large) wingsuit.
    I developped it after loosing a handfull of good base jumping friends. I am convinced that the wingtip pouch can save lives."

    Doesn't look like this is something that would be advantageous for mid size wingsuits in the skydiving environment. I don't fly big suits or base jump though so maybe the people who do will see more potential in this
